The Core Mechanics of Paylines in Video Slots

Traditional fruit machines operated on simple payline concepts, usually a single horizontal line across the centre. However, modern videos slots have vastly expanded this framework toinclude multiple paylines, sometimes numbering in the hundreds or even thousands. This development not only heightens excitement but also diversifies potential winning combinations.

Wild Symbols: The Game Changer for Payouts

Central to boosting winning potential are wild symbols, designed to substitute for other icons and complete winning line combinations. Recent game innovations include “stacked wilds” — a feature where wilds appear stacked across reels, significantly increasing the chance of creating multiple winning lines simultaneously.
